Do I need my VIN?

No, but it helps a lot. Many models changed parts partway through a production year, so a VIN is often the only way to be certain which part fits. If you cannot get to the bike, your make, model and year is enough for us to start.

Where do I find my VIN?

It is a 17-character number stamped on the frame, usually on the steering head under the front of the seat or behind a panel near the footwell. It is also printed on your registration papers and compliance plate. It never contains the letters I, O or Q.

What is an engine code and do I need it?

It is the number stamped into the engine case, and it is optional. It matters for engine internals, because the same model is sometimes sold with more than one engine, but for most parts the make, model and year is enough.

What if I do not know the name of the part I need?

Describe it as best you can, or tell us what the bike is doing and what you think has failed. We work these out every day. If you have a part number from another supplier or a manual, include that and we will cross-reference it.
